Here’s what you’ll do:

  • Act as a Design Lead for elements of a project, liaising directly with clients and the wider design team for the day to day design development but being guided by a Technical Lead / mentor
  • Manage more junior engineers in the design of infrastructure elements

You will ideally be educated to degree level in Civil or Civil & Structural Engineering, and/or have MSc/MEng in Soil Mechanics/ Geotechnical/ Tunnelling Engineering, with/working towards a professional membership.

You will have broad experience as a designer in Reinforced Concrete to Eurocodes in relation to underground structures such as secant piles, capping beams, segmental shaft linings, in situ concrete structural elements, D-Walls, shafts and tunnels.

A Civil or Structural Engineer with good familiarity of Geotechnical Engineering principles as they apply to soil-structure interaction.
